The Korea Brand Reputation Research Institute compiles these rankings based on multiple factors, including media activity, consumer participation, communication, and community index. For the evaluation period spanning January 8 to February 8, SEVENTEEN emerged as the frontrunner, showcasing their strong connection with fans and media presence.
Breaking Down the Rankings
The brand reputation rankings reflect the power of influence and engagement within the K-pop industry. SEVENTEEN secured first place with a brand reputation index of 5,418,828, surpassing BTS, who came in second with 5,188,423. Stray Kids followed in third place with 2,628,900, while legendary group BIGBANG took the fourth spot with 2,531,841. TWS rounded out the top five with 2,455,079.
A deeper analysis of SEVENTEEN’s ranking reveals some key elements contributing to their success. Their keyword analysis highlighted trending terms such as “commemorative medal,” “Asia tour,” and “CARAT,” reflecting their recent achievements and strong fan engagement. Additionally, the group received an overwhelming 92.21 percent positive reaction in their positivity-negativity analysis, emphasizing their strong public perception and dedicated fanbase.
